-You can now only hear from headsets when it is on your ear slot. People around you won't be able to hear your headset anymore.

-The firedoor wasn't updating the freelook camera. When I looked at it I couldn't figure out why it was using it's own "rebuild" code, supposedly it only updates the air that it set in the dir variable but the current map doesn't utilize it at all (firelocks with a dir of 8 which are lined horizontalally), and you would have to have two thick wide firelocks to make it effective. I've commented it out and I'll put it back in if we have problems.

git-svn-id: http://tgstation13.googlecode.com/svn/trunk@4832 316c924e-a436-60f5-8080-3fe189b3f50e
This commit is contained in:
giacomand@gmail.com
2012-10-08 03:52:25 +00:00
parent 86fe18f32f
commit eb68c1e510
6 changed files with 36 additions and 22 deletions

View File

@@ -30,18 +30,18 @@
/obj/item/device/radio/intercom/receive_range(freq, level)
if (!on)
return 0
return -1
if (!(src.wires & WIRE_RECEIVE))
return 0
return -1
if(level != 0)
var/turf/position = get_turf(src)
if(isnull(position) || position.z != level)
return 0
return -1
if (!src.listening)
return 0
return -1
if(freq == SYND_FREQ)
if(!(src.syndie))
return 0//Prevents broadcast of messages over devices lacking the encryption
return -1//Prevents broadcast of messages over devices lacking the encryption
return canhear_range